The Ordinary Natural Moisturizing Factors + HA or NMF for short, is infused with multiple amino acids, in combination with fatty acids, triglycerides, urea, ceramides, phospholipids, glycerin, saccharides, sodium PCA, hyaluronic acid and many other compounds that are naturally present in the skin. This moisturizer has all three recommended ingredients that make up a good moisturizer (humectants, emollients and occlusives). Some of these main ingredients will be explained below. The Ordinary Natural Moisturizing Factors moisturizer is not too matte or dewy, so if you would prefer those finishes, you should try a different moisturizer.Natural Moisturizing Factors are necessary for optimal hydration in the stratum corneum, the outermost layer of the skin. Natural Moisturizing Factors bind and hold water in the stratum corneum, which leads to increased hydration and improved skin elasticity. Ingredients: Natural Moisturizing Factors (NMFs) are a combination of amino acids, fatty acids, triglycerides, urea, ceramides, phospholipids, glycerin, hyaluronic acid, and other compounds that are found naturally in the skin and work together to keep the skin hydrated and moisturized. Allantoin: Allantoin, also known as aluminum dihydroxy allantoinate, is an extract from the comfrey plant, which is native to temperate climates of Asia and Europe. Allantoin acts as an emollient, which soothes and keeps your skin moisturized and prevents dryness and irritation. It helps the dead skin cells fall off, helps the skin keep in more water, and leaves the skin feeling smoother and softer.

Amino acids: The Ordinary Natural Moisturizing Factors + HA contains multiple amino acids such as; arginine, histidine and proline, to help restore visible skin damage, soothes the skin and supply antioxidant properties, strengthen skin surface thereby making fine lines and wrinkles less deep. Natural Moisturizing Factors are formed from filaggrin, a type of protein that’s found in the skin. When the skin’s NMF levels are depleted, the skin can become dry, rough, and flaky.
